Title: Lilian Sylvia Fernandes: Innovator in Network Technologies
Introduction
Lilian Sylvia Fernandes is a prominent inventor based in Bengaluru, India. She has made significant contributions to the field of network technologies, holding a total of 3 patents. Her innovative work focuses on enhancing network efficiency and security through advanced methodologies.
Latest Patents
One of her latest patents is titled "System and method for discovering multipoint endpoints in a network environment." This method involves multicasting a discovery packet in an overlay network, which includes a Layer 2 scheme over a Layer 3 network. It identifies endpoints based on their responses to the discovery packet, particularly focusing on disconnected endpoints that do not respond.
Another notable patent is "System and method for identity based authentication in a distributed virtual switch network environment." This method includes forwarding user credentials from a virtual machine in a distributed virtual switch (DVS) network to an external network element. It facilitates the enforcement of user policies within the DVS network, ensuring secure access for users attempting to connect to virtual machines.
